Gov. Center Intervention
Elevated Path : Miami, Florida


The Project developed as an intervention for Downtown Government Center. The driving force was an integrated urban sensing and footprint. The goal, to go from a nucleus to a systematic network. The new Miami Museum would be the gateway for creating a new enhanced form of transportation. An elevated bike path would emerge from its core allowing for growth and spread throughout all of downtown creating a new urban layer.
